The True Story of BMF Entertainment

Purdy’s storyline is a dramatization of Demetrius Flenory's (Big Meech) real-life passion project. Around the year 2000, as the BMF drug-trafficking organization expanded into Atlanta, Big Meech became increasingly drawn to the city's burgeoning hip-hop scene. This led to the creation of BMF Entertainment, which served two primary purposes:

  • Money Laundering: The music label provided a seemingly legitimate way to wash the vast amounts of cash generated by the drug empire.
  • Status and Influence: It gave Big Meech the celebrity status he craved, allowing him to rub shoulders with high-profile artists and become a fixture in hip-hop culture.

The fictional label Stomping Ground Records, where Meech and Terry sign Purdy, is a clear stand-in for the real BMF Entertainment. The show uses Purdy to explore the complexity of this new venture—the glamour, the high stakes, and the inherent conflict between the street life and the music business.

Who Purdy *Might* Be Based On: The Real BMF Artists

While Purdy herself is fictional, she is a composite character that embodies the type of artists BMF Entertainment sought to promote and sign. To satisfy the curiosity about who she is "supposed to be," we must look at the real people connected to the Flenory brothers' music label.

1. Bleu DaVinci: The Real Signed Artist

The closest real-life equivalent to a signed artist on the BMF label is Bleu DaVinci. He was the *sole* artist officially signed to BMF Entertainment. His career was directly tied to the organization's rise and fall, making him the most authentic parallel to Purdy's role as the flagship talent on Stomping Ground Records.

2. Young Jeezy and T.I.: The Promoted Stars

BMF Entertainment was more famous for its role as a high-profile promoter than as a traditional record label. They were instrumental in the early careers of major Atlanta hip-hop figures. The organization helped launch the career of Young Jeezy and was associated with promoting other established and rising artists, including T.I. Purdy, as an "up-and-coming musician" with "bars, beauty, and baggage," represents the type of promising talent that Big Meech would have invested in to boost his reputation and expand his influence in the Atlanta music scene.
